PSLEJoelle had two streamers of the same length. She cut the first streamer into equal parts of length 40 cm and to each part she tied 2 white balls. After that, she cut the second streamer into equal parts of length 45 cm and to each part she tied 5 brown balls. When she finished tying, she counted that there were 66 more brown balls than white balls. How many balls were there altogether?

LCM of 40 and 45 = 360
Number of sets of 2 white balls in a length of 360 cm
= 360 ÷ 40
= 9
Number of white balls in a length of 360 cm
= 9 x 2
= 18
Number of sets of 5 brown balls in a length of 360 cm
= 360 ÷ 45
= 8
Number of brown balls in a length of 360 cm
= 8 x 5
= 40
Extra number of brown balls in a length of 360 cm
= 40 - 18
= 22
Number of sets of balls
= 66 ÷ 22
= 3
Total number of balls in one set of 360 cm of white balloons and one set of 360 cm of brown balloons
= 18 + 40
= 58
Total number of balls of the two streamers
= 3 x 58
= 174
Answer(s): 174
